Embedded Systems Research Group
Embedded computing systems will play a dominant role in the coming decades. They will deliver more powerful services in traditional application domains such as aviation, military, telecommunications and process control. Due to the falling price of hardware and the trend towards ubiquitous networking, embedded computing will also become a key component of many common place applications and household products In these domains, "lay-consumers" will demand a level of reliability and predictability not normally expected from traditional computer software. This calls for an design process that is effective and reliable but which also has a fast turn-around time as well as the ability to build -with minimal additional effort- many customized versions of the same product. Such a design process should encompass multiple levels of system-descriptions and the means for going form one level of description to a neighboring one while preserving behavior and the integrity of the design.. The various levels of descriptions should range from requirements and proceed all the way down to software-hardware implementation.
